What kinds of FRQs to expect
Concept Application: Respond to a political scenario, describe and explain the effects of a political institution, behavior, or process
Quantitative Analysis: Analyze quantitative data, identify a trend or pattern, or draw a conclusion from a visual representation and explain how it relates to a political principle, institution, process, policy, or behavior
SCOTUS Comparison: Compare a nonrequired Supreme Court case with a required Supreme Court case, explaining how information from the required case is relevant to the nonrequired one
Argument Essay: Develop an argument in the form of an essay, using evidence from required foundational documents and course concepts
